5 Jul 2010The Chargepod, the most versatile charger for cell phones and mobile devices, is now available in over 2,500 Verizon stores in the United States. Verizon is offering a specially designed and customized value-pack for only $49.95. The value pack includes a base unit, wall charger, carrying pouch, micro-USB adapter plus a voucher which allows consumers to get Three Free device adapters of their choice.

16 Jun 2010Fairpoint Communications utterly imploded after regulators rubber stamped their acquisition of Verizon’s unwanted New England (Maine, Vermont and New Hampshire) DSL and landline networks, though the company insists they should be able to exit bankruptcy by the end of the summer.
